New technology creates 'best practice' for signal and power integrity analysis

  • signal integrity

With Ansoft Designer 6.0's new Solver on Demand technology from ANSYS, electronic design engineers can quickly and accurately analyse signal integrity, power integrity and emi problems from a single schematic and layout-based environment.

Ansoft Designer 6.0 is said to enable high speed electronics and rf/microwave designers to access field and circuit simulation tools while designing electronic packages and pcbs early in the design cycle before manufacturing costs are incurred.

Solver on Demand technology integrates HFSS 3d electromagnetic field simulation software from ANSYS and HSPICE, an integrated circuit simulation tool from Synopsys within the Ansoft Designer 6.0 design platform.
The resulting benchmark design flow offers the ability to predict how high frequency electromagnetic components affect the integrated circuits. The design platform brings the power of HFSS 3d modelling to the layout and allows it to be combined with encrypted HSPICE models.

Addressing the challenges that electromagnetic field simulation raises, HFSS has been built directly into Ansoft Designer 6.0. Models of rfic layout, ic packages and pcbs from Cadence Design Systems, Mentor Graphics and Zuken can be imported directly to Ansoft Designer and solved in HFSS without any further setup. The package layout can be parameterised to compute tuning and sensitivity to understand impedance variations due to process.

Ansoft Designer 6.0 is said to provide a powerful user interface to HSPICE with direct links to HFSS and access to the ANSYS QuickEye and VerifEye convolution and statistical eye analysis as well as IBIS-AMI technology.
